[解決済み] 緯度・経度の正しいデータ型は?(activerecord内)
2023-08-01 07:28:35
質問
緯度と経度は文字列と浮動小数点(または他のもの)のどちらで保存すべきでしょうか?
(重要であれば、私はactiverecord / ruby on railsを使用しています)。
更新しました。
開発ではMysql、本番ではpostgresql(なぜそれが重要なのか?)
どのように解決するのか?
より複雑な地理的計算を行う必要がある場合、次のことを調べることができます。 ポストGIS を、Postgresqlの場合は MySQL 空間拡張 を使用してください。 それ以外の場合は、float(倍精度が良いかもしれません)であれば動作します。
編集してください。 のようです。 ジオ・ルビー ライブラリには、前述の両方のデータベースの空間/GIS拡張を操作するためのRails拡張が含まれているようです。
関連
-
[解決済み】警告:定数 ::Fixnum は非推奨 新しいモデルを生成するとき
-
[解決済み] DestroyとDeleteの違い
-
[解決済み] rspecにおけるassignsの意味
-
[解決済み] サーバーはRailsで既に稼働している
-
[解決済み] Rails 4で、以前のバージョンのRailsでattr_accessibleを使用していた状況に遭遇した場合、Forbidden Attributes Errorが発生する。
-
[解決済み] Ruby on Railsで、DateTime、Timestamp、Time、Dateの違いは何ですか?
-
[解決済み] 実行時にメソッドが定義されている場所を見つけるには?
-
[解決済み】ActiveRecordのFloatとDecimalの比較
-
[解決済み] Rails は、データベースに対して実行されたマイグレーションをどのように追跡しているのですか?
-
Rails ActiveRecordは、複数のクエリを使用せずに、どのように「where」句を連鎖させるのですか?
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
[解決済み】Bundler: コマンドが見つからない
-
[解決済み】Rails 4 RoutingError: ルートが一致しない[POST]。
-
[解決済み] heroku open - no app specified
-
[解決済み] heroku push rejected, failed to compile Ruby/rails app
-
[解決済み] railsでhidden fieldタグを使用する方法
-
[解決済み] Devise Admin Roleの追加【終了しました
-
[解決済み] bundle install --without production は何をするのですか?
-
[解決済み] レイル 4 radio_button_tag default not selected
-
[解決済み] ActionController::RoutingError: 初期化されていない定数MicropostsController
-
[解決済み] MySQLデータベースに緯度/経度を格納する際に使用する理想的なデータ型は何ですか?